Make sure to find the best builds and team comps for Sparkle in release of Honkai: Star Rail 2.0, which kicked off the second year of content for the turn-based RPG by HoYoverse. Sparkle made her debut in Phase 2 banners of the update and is now considered a limited-time character, meaning players can only obtain her whenever she comes into rotation in the banner system.

Sparkle specializes in boosting her team’s total Skill Points and increasing their overall damage output whenever they consume these points. In addition to that, she is a reliable for the main DPS, as she can increase their CRIT DMG and advance their action. Sparkle is a little bit complicated to build at first as she deviates from the pattern of other Harmony units with some unusual stat scaling, but building her properly and inserting her in the proper team comps in Honkai: Star Rail is worth it, as you will likely see your newfound party powering through tough encounters.

Best Light Cones For Sparkle

Honkai Star Rail's Sparkle smiles gently.

The best Light Cone for Sparkle is Earthly Escapade, her signature 5-star gear that can only be obtained from limited banners whenever Sparkle is in the gacha system. Earthly Escapade increases Sparkle’s CRIT DMG by 32% and, at the start of the battle, she gains Mask for three turns. Mask increases her allies' CRIT Rate by 10% and their CRIT DMG by 28%. Additionally, for every Skill Point recovered by Sparkle (likely via her Talent in Honkai: Star Rail), she gains Radiant Flame. When four stacks of Radiant Flame are obtained and consumed, they grant Mask for four turns.

The CRIT DMG buff provided through Sparkle's Skill scales off of her own CRIT DMG, making it a vital stat to have. This is part of what makes Earthly Escapade the perfect fit for her.

If her signature weapon is not available, you can use the 5-star But the Battle Isn’t Over Light Cone. This will increase Sparkle’s Energy Regeneration Rate by 10% and regenerate one Skill Point whenever she uses her Ultimate on an ally. The effect can be triggered once every two uses of her Ultimate. When Sparkle uses her Skill, the next ally taking action deals 30% more DMG for one turn. While it does not provide a CRIT DMG boost, it fits in with most of Sparkle’s abilities in Honkai: Star Rail, making it the best 5-star substitute currently available.

If the aforementioned 5-star weapons are not available, you have some 4-star Light Cone options to choose from. Dreamville Adventure, introduced with the region of Penacony in Version 2.0, can increase allies’ DMG by 12% if they use the same type of ability most recently used by Sparkle herself. Alternatively, you can use Past and Future, which boosts the next ally’s DMG by 16% after Sparkle uses her Skill. Carve the Moon, Weave the Clouds is also a decent option in Honkai: Star Rail, though the bonus effect provided by the Light Cone will be randomized in each encounter.

Currently, Carve the Moon, Weave the Clouds is the only 4-star Harmony Light Cone that provides a CRIT DMG boost, but its effect is temporary for the battle and there is no guarantee it will be activated, as the weapon can provide one of three buffs every encounter.

Best Relics, Ornaments, & Stats For Sparkle

When it comes to the Relics that Sparkle should equip, there is only one set that makes sense for her at the moment. Though it does not give her CRIT DMG, Messenger Traversing Hackerspace does fit her needs as a . With two pieces, Sparkle gets a 6% SPD boost, while the four-piece bonus sees that, whenever she uses her Ultimate on an ally, SPD for all allies increases by 12% for one turn. The Genius of Brilliant Stars set can improve Quantum DMG, but it isn’t recommended as Sparkle’s focus is not dealing damage in Honkai: Star Rail.

Despite Sparkle’s scaling on CRIT DMG, she is not a damage dealer and should not be considered as such. Instead, focus on building her as a complete unit.

In contrast to Relics, there are different Planar Ornaments for her. The best Ornament set for Sparkle is Sprightly Vonwacq. These items increase her Energy Regeneration Rate by 5% and, when her SPD reaches 120 or higher, Sparkle’s action is Advanced Forward by 40% when entering battle. Alternatively, you can use Penacony, Land of the Dreams, which also boosts Sparkle’s Energy Regeneration Rate by 5% but increases DMG for all allies with the same DMG type as her by 10% – this is particularly good if your DPS is of the Quantum element in Honkai: Star Rail.

The last possible set is Celestial Differentiator. This Ornament set boosts Sparkle’s CRIT DMG by 16% and, when her CRIT DMG reaches 120% or higher, after entering battle, her CRIT Rate increases by 60% until the end of her first attack. This set should only be used as a temporary solution to a low CRIT DMG stat. You should try to increase Sparkle’s CRIT DMG through stats, sub-stats, and her Light Cone, if possible. Equipping Celestial Differentiator cuts off some of her potential as a character in Honkai: Star Rail.

When farming these Relics and Ornaments for Sparkle, you should focus on trying to get as much CRIT DMG as you can, followed by SPD and Energy Regeneration Rate. CRIT DMG will improve the quality of the buffs she provides to teammates, while SPD will allow her to act sooner and, hopefully, before the party’s DPS. Energy Regeneration will allow her to have her Ultimate up more often, thus increasing allies’ DMG through the consumption of Skill Points in Honkai: Star Rail. HP is also a useful sub-stat for her to have, as it can boost her survivability.

Best Team Comps For Sparkle

The ideal team comps for Sparkle are those that hypercarry a single DPS for an insane amount of damage. Because of how Sparkle rewards her team with more DMG based on Skill Point, consumption, it is best to have a Skill Point-hungry team. Imbibitor Lunae consumes a lot when he is attacking at full charge, while certain healers and secondary s can use Skill Points every turn.

Players can play around with a mono-Quantum team if the situation makes sense. If players are looking for a budget-friendly team that does not require extra 5-star units, consider using Misha as the DPS, as he also increases his damage output based on Skill Point consumption, making him a great ally for Sparkle, as she provides extra Skill Points to use and rewards him when the team consumes them. Honkai: Star Rail’s Sparkle is at her best in teams that demand a lot of Skill Points, but her kit allows her to fit in well with several team comps.

Skill Priority For Sparkle

When you are Ascending and leveling up Sparkle’s abilities, you will need to treat her Skill, Ultimate, and Talent with equal priority. Her Skill is what gives her DPS a boost to CRIT DMG and her Ultimate and Talent are what trigger the Skill Point mechanic that grants a DMG buff, so they are all equally important. Her Basic Attack is the least relevant part of her kit and can be left for later, if not completely ignored should you lack the resources in Honkai: Star Rail.

Building Sparkle can start a little bit difficult due to how her stats scale, but if given the proper treatment and farming is taken seriously, she can be shaped into one of the best units in the game. Additionally, Sparkle may as well be the best companion for Imbibitor Lunae so far. Be sure to take advantage of the extra Skill Points and the Skill Point restoration that she provides to increase your team’s overall damage output in Honkai: Star Rail.
